LUPOTO
Permit 2214. 100% Tiger Resources
The Lupoto Project has a surface area of 140sq km and is located approximately 10km to the south of the Kipoi Project area.
The same structures and lithologies which host the Kipoi deposits have been identified as extending into the northeast of the permit over a distance of at least 3km.
Programmes undertaken include detailed aeromagnetic surveys, geological mapping, soil sampling programmes and air core drilling to test three high priority soil anomalies, Sase, Kapampala and Mwana.
At Sase Central, Tiger has defined an Indicated resource of 3.1Mt at 1.6% Cu containing 49,000 tonnes of copper (and 2,000 tonnes of cobalt) and an Inferred resource of 11.6Mt at 1.3% Cu containing 151,000 tonnes of copper (and 5,000 tonnes of cobalt).
